Sdílet prostřednictvím


SolutionConfigurations.Add – metoda

Vytvoří novou konfiguraci řešení založené na již existující.

Obor názvů:  EnvDTE
Sestavení:  EnvDTE (v EnvDTE.dll)

Syntaxe

'Deklarace
Function Add ( _
    NewName As String, _
    ExistingName As String, _
    Propagate As Boolean _
) As SolutionConfiguration
SolutionConfiguration Add(
    string NewName,
    string ExistingName,
    bool Propagate
)
SolutionConfiguration^ Add(
    [InAttribute] String^ NewName, 
    [InAttribute] String^ ExistingName, 
    [InAttribute] bool Propagate
)
abstract Add : 
        NewName:string * 
        ExistingName:string * 
        Propagate:bool -> SolutionConfiguration 
function Add(
    NewName : String, 
    ExistingName : String, 
    Propagate : boolean
) : SolutionConfiguration

Parametry

  • NewName
    Typ: System.String
    Povinné.Název nové konfigurace řešení.
  • Propagate
    Typ: System.Boolean
    Povinné. True Pokud by šířit nové konfigurace řešení, False Pokud není.Pokud Propagate je nastavena na True, pak nově přidaného roztoku konfigurace bude automaticky přidán do všech projektů v rámci řešení, jakož i samotný řešení.

Vrácená hodnota

Typ: EnvDTE.SolutionConfiguration
Objekt SolutionConfiguration.

Poznámky

AddVytvoří novou konfiguraci řešení založené na jeden s názvem v ExistingName.Nové konfigurace řešení používá stejné konfigurace projektu pro konfiguraci a platformu kontexty.Pokud ExistingName je prázdný, pak Add vytvoří novou konfiguraci řešení založené na výchozí hodnoty.

Výchozí konfigurace řešení obsahuje všechny projekty a označí všechny projekty, které má být vytvořena.Kromě toho zvolí konfigurace projektu, které jsou aktivní při aktivaci konfiguraci řešení, s výhradou následujících pokynů:

  • Názvy konfigurace projektu, které odpovídají zcela novou konfiguraci řešení název včetně velkých a malých, jsou zvolena.

  • Není-li takové shody je zvolen libovolné konfigurace název projektu, který obsahuje název projektu konfigurace.

  • Pokud neexistuje je zvolen libovolné konfigurace projektu pro projekt v rámci projektu uvedeny jako první.Úmluva je nejprve seznam konfiguraci ladění projektu, pokud je podpora s názvem.

Zabezpečení rozhraní .NET Framework

Viz také

Referenční dokumentace

SolutionConfigurations Rozhraní

EnvDTE – obor názvů